Substrate Requirement

  • Nutrient-Rich Substrate: Provide a substrate rich in nutrients to support the plant’s root development and overall growth. Choose substrates specifically formulated for planted aquariums, or supplement with root tabs to ensure adequate nutrient availability.
  • Grain Size: The substrate should have a medium grain size that allows for proper root anchorage while also facilitating nutrient absorption. Avoid substrates with excessively large grains that may hinder root penetration or compact too tightly, restricting nutrient flow.
  • Depth: Aim for a substrate depth of at least 2 to 3 inches (5 to 7.5 centimeters) to accommodate Ludwigia inclinata’s root system. A deeper substrate provides ample space for root growth and promotes stability for the plants.
  • CO2 Substrate: If you’re supplementing carbon dioxide (CO2) in your aquarium, consider using a CO2-enriched substrate or substrate additives. These can help maximize CO2 availability to the plant roots, enhancing growth and vitality.

Ludwigia Peruensis Cultivation Tips

  • Nutrient Availability: Ludwigia peruensis is a nutrient-hungry plant. Supplement the aquarium with a comprehensive liquid fertilizer or root tabs to ensure adequate nutrient availability. Pay attention to dosing instructions to prevent nutrient deficiencies or excesses.
  • CO2 Supplementation: Consider supplementing carbon dioxide (CO2) if possible. CO2 injection can enhance the growth and coloration of Ludwigia peruensis, promoting lush foliage and intensifying its red hues. However, the plant can still thrive in tanks without CO2 supplementation.
  • Pruning and Maintenance: Regularly trim and prune the stems to encourage bushy growth and prevent overcrowding. Remove any dead or decaying plant material to maintain water quality and prevent nutrient imbalances. Additionally, remove any side shoots to encourage vertical growth.
  • Propagation: Ludwigia peruensis can be propagated by stem cuttings. Simply trim healthy stems and replant them in the substrate. Ensure that each cutting has several nodes to promote root development. Regular pruning also stimulates new growth and helps maintain the plant’s shape.
  • Water Flow: Provide moderate water flow to ensure nutrient distribution and prevent debris buildup on the plant’s foliage. Adequate water circulation is essential for delivering nutrients and CO2 to the plants while preventing algae growth.

Plant Propagation Tips

  1. Select Healthy Stems: Choose stems that are healthy, free from damage, and exhibit vibrant coloration. Avoid stems that show signs of disease, decay, or pest infestation.
  2. Prepare Stem Cuttings: Use sharp, clean scissors or aquascaping tools to trim stem cuttings from the parent plant. Cut the stems at a 45-degree angle to maximize the surface area for rooting. Each cutting should be approximately 3 to 6 inches (7.5 to 15 centimeters) in length, with at least two leaf nodes.
  3. Remove Lower Leaves: Strip away the lower leaves from each stem cutting, leaving only a few leaves near the tip. This reduces the demand for nutrients and helps prevent rotting when the stems are planted in the substrate.
  4. Planting Stem Cuttings: Plant the prepared stem cuttings directly into the substrate of the aquarium. Insert each cutting into the substrate, burying the lower portion of the stem while leaving the upper portion and remaining leaves exposed. Space the cuttings a few inches apart to prevent overcrowding.
